Carousel

Israel, 2024, 10 minutes, Hebrew with Hebrew subtitles

The film follows a couple and their friend visiting from London during their vacation at the Dead Sea on October 7, 2023. The experience is depicted through three time periods, shifting from denial to moments of rupture. Tel Aviv University

Director: Guy Hamiel
Script: Guy Hamiel
Producer: Guy Hamiel
With: Amit Berman, Christopher Hartmann, Guy Hamiel

Will We Always Have Paris?

Israel, 2025, 5 minutes, Hebrew with Hebrew subtitles

In 2024, as war echoed in Israel, we spent a month in Paris with my partner. Edith, my devoted Filipino caregiver, came too. Since my accident, I have been dependent on her. In uncertain times like these days, I search for where home really is.

Director: Rona Soffer
Script: Rona Soffer
Producer: Rona Soffer
With: Edith Bandoy, Rona Soffer

Blue Window

Israel, 2025, 7 minutes, Hebrew with Hebrew subtitles

Nitay and I have been friends for a few years. We met when we moved in together with other friends to a communal apartment in Afula. On her last night in the city, just before moving to Tel Aviv, we sat down for a conversation that stretched late into the night. Between getting ready to meet a hookup and packing the last of her things, we talked about her life , about men, control, love, connection. Through her words, a portrait emerges, not only of Nitay herself, but of an emotional and queer experience of identity, at a moment when something ends, and something else might just begin. Hamidrasha – Faculty of Arts.

Director: Ofir Ouliel
Script: Ofir Ouliel
Producer: Ofir Ouliel
With: Nitay Nadivi
